Who gets a LHW title shot if they win - Chuck, Jardine, Machida, Rashad, or Shogun?

After Rampage and Forrest face off for the title in probably July or August, who in this stacked LHW division should get the first crack?

All have good and bad points, so it is not gonna be easy after all the fights are said and done to grant the shot.

Personally, if Jardine beats Wand, he needs the next shot. That's 3 quality wins over Top 10 opponents (Forrest, Chuck, Wand), something I don't think anyone else can brag about.

If Forrest beats Rampage, then either Chuck (due to his popularity) or Jardine (to set up the rematch with Forrest).

If Rampage beats Forrest, then probably Machida (he has to get the shot sooner or later if he keeps winning) or Shogun (to set up a rematch with Rampage).

Either case Rashad IMO still needs more big wins.

Assuming he beats Tito, Machida easily. All the other contenders have some losses you can't ignore, or simply lackluster performances. Jardine lost to Houston, Chuck lost to Jardine, Shogun JUST lost, Rashad despite being undefeated hasnt been very impressive, then you got guys like Thiago Silva who are simply unproven. Machida IMO, but then again they DID give Forrest a title shot so who knows what that maniac of a matchmaker will do.
